i trying cpu, memory, network data using getsummarydata. (service: softlayer_metric_tracking_object)
url:http://sldn.softlayer.com/reference/services/softlayer_metric_tracking_object/getsummarydata
"validtype" parameter of "getsummarydata" have keyname, name, summarytype, unit properties.(datatype: softlayer_container_metric_data_type)
url:http://sldn.softlayer.com/reference/datatypes/softlayer_container_metric_data_type
my question:
i want know value of these parameters. know value of following. please tell me if there other value in each case.
- in cpu case:
keyname : cpu0,cpu1,...,cpun
name : cpu
summarytype: average/max/sum - in memory case: keyname : memory_usage
name : memory_usage
summarytype: average/max/sum - in network case:
keyname : publicin_net_octet/publicout_net_octet/privatein_net_octet/privateout_net_octet
name : publicin_net_octet/publicout_net_octet/privatein_net_octet/privateout_net_octet
summarytype: average/max/sum
- in cpu case:
would use "unit" parameter?
tried change value of "unit" parameter. tried set "gb" value of "counter" no change. (please refer curl command , parameter of following )
please tell me valid value of "unit" parameter if "unit" parameter enable.
curl
curl -k "config file" -x post -d @"parameter" 'https://api.softlayer.com/rest/v3/softlayer_metric_tracking_object/"object id"/getsummarydata.json'
parameter
pattern1
{"parameters":["08/16/2016", "08/16/2016",[{"keyname":"memory_usage","summarytype":"max","unit":"gb"}],600]}
pattern2
{"parameters":["08/16/2016", "08/16/2016",[{"keyname":"memory_usage","summarytype":"max","unit":"kb"}],600]}
pattern3
{"parameters":["08/16/2016", "08/16/2016",[{"keyname":"memory_usage","summarytype":"max"}],600]}
additional:
executed "getmetricdatatypes".
keyname , name ok summarytype counter , average only. sum , max nothing.
there other summarytype?
to values parameters, try method:
regarding unit property:
unfortunately, it's not possible set property other kind of type of value
Comments
Post a Comment